Actualización de un pool de nodos virtuales
Descubra cómo actualizar un pool de nodos virtuales mediante Kubernetes Engine (OKE).
Para obtener información general sobre la actualización de pools de nodos, consulte Modificación de las propiedades del pool de nodos y del nodo de trabajador.
- En la página de lista Clusters, seleccione el nombre del cluster que desea modificar. Si necesita ayuda para encontrar la página de lista o el cluster, consulte Listing Clusters.
- Seleccione el separador Pools de nodos y, a continuación, seleccione el nombre del pool de nodos virtual que desea modificar.
En el separador Detalles del pool de nodos virtual, se muestra información sobre el pool de nodos virtual, incluidos los siguientes detalles:
- El estado del pool de nodos.
- El OCID del pool de nodos.
- El tipo de nodos de trabajador en el pool de nodos (virtual).
- Configuración utilizada actualmente al iniciar nuevos nodos virtuales en el pool de nodos, incluida la siguiente información:
- La versión de Kubernetes que se debe ejecutar en los nodos de trabajador.
- Unidad que se utilizará para los nosos de trabajador.
- Los dominios de disponibilidad, los dominios de errores y diferentes subredes regionales (se recomienda) o subredes específicas de dominio de disponibilidad que alojan nodos de trabajador.
-
Cambie las propiedades del pool de nodos virtuales y del nodo virtual de la siguiente manera:
- En el menú Acciones, seleccione Editar y especifique:
- Nombre: nombre diferente para el pool de nodos. Evite introducir información confidencial.
- Recuento de nodos: el número de nodos virtuales que debe crearse en el pool de nodo virtual, situado en los dominios de disponibilidad que seleccione, y en la subred regional (recomendado) o en el subred específica de dominio que especifique para cada dominio del servicio. Consulte Escalado de pools de nodos.
- Configuración de colocación de nodo:
- Dominio de Disponibilidad: dominio de Disponibilidad en el que colocar nodos virtuales.
- Dominios de errores: (opcional) uno o más dominios de errores en el dominio de disponibilidad en el que colocar los nodos virtuales.
De manera opcional, seleccione Agregar fila para seleccionar más dominios en los que colocar los nodos virtuales.
Cuando se crean los nodos virtuales, se distribuyen lo más equitativamente posible en los dominios de disponibilidad y los dominios de errores que seleccione. Si no selecciona ningún dominio de errores para un dominio de disponibilidad concreto, los nodos virtuales se distribuyen lo más equitativamente posible en todos los dominios de errores de ese dominio de disponibilidad.
- Comunicación de nodo virtual:
- Compartimento de subred: compartimento en el que reside la subred del nodo virtual.
- Subred: subred regional diferente (recomendado) o subred específica del dominio de disponibilidad configurada para alojar nodos virtuales. Si especificó subredes del equilibrio de carga, las subredes del nodo virtual deben ser diferentes. Las subredes que especifique pueden ser privadas (recomendado) o públicas y pueden ser regionales (recomendado) o específicas de dominio de disponibilidad. Recomendamos que la subred de pod y la subred de nodo virtual sean la misma subred (en cuyo caso, la subred de nodo virtual debe ser privada). Para obtener más información, consulte Subnet Configuration.
- Usar reglas de seguridad en el grupo de seguridad de red (NSG): controle el acceso a la subred del nodo virtual mediante reglas de seguridad definidas para uno o más grupos de seguridad de red (NSG) que especifique (hasta un máximo de cinco). Puede utilizar reglas de seguridad definidas para los NSG en lugar de las definidas para las listas de seguridad (se recomiendan los NSG). Para obtener más información sobre las reglas de seguridad que se deben especificar para el NSG, consulte Reglas de seguridad para nodos y pods de trabajador.
- Comunicación con los pods:
- Compartimento de subred: compartimento en el que reside la subred del pod.
- Subred: subred regional diferente configurada para alojar pods. La subred de pod que especifique para los nodos virtuales debe ser privada. Recomendamos que la subred de pod y la subred de nodo virtual sean la misma subred (en cuyo caso, Oracle recomienda definir reglas de seguridad en los grupos de seguridad de red en lugar de en las listas de seguridad). Para obtener más información, consulte Subnet Configuration.
- Usar reglas de seguridad en el grupo de seguridad de red (NSG): controle el acceso a la subred de pod mediante reglas de seguridad definidas para uno o más grupos de seguridad de red (NSG) que especifique (hasta un máximo de cinco). Puede utilizar reglas de seguridad definidas para los NSG en lugar de las definidas para las listas de seguridad (se recomiendan los NSG). Para obtener más información sobre las reglas de seguridad que se deben especificar para el NSG, consulte Reglas de seguridad para nodos y pods de trabajador.
Para obtener más información sobre la comunicación de pod, consulte Redes de pod.
- etiquetas de Kubernetes: (opcional) una o más etiquetas (además de una etiqueta por defecto) para agregar a los nodos virtuales en el pool del nodo virtual a fin del objetivo de permitir el targeting de cargas de trabajo en pools de nodo específicos. Para obtener más información, consulte Asignación de pods a nodos en la documentación de Kubernetes.
- Contenido de Kubernetes: (opcional) uno o más elementos que se deben agregar a los nodos virtuales en el pool de nodos virtuales. Los contaminantes permiten que los nodos virtuales repelan los pods, por lo que deben asegurarse de que los pods no se ejecuten en nodos virtuales en un pool de nodos virtuales concreto. Puede aplicar los mantos solo a los nodos virtuales. Para obtener más información, consulte Asignación de pods a nodos en la documentación de Kubernetes.
- Seleccione Actualizar para guardar las propiedades actualizadas.
- En el menú Acciones, seleccione Editar y especifique:
- Utilice el separador Etiquetas y manchas de Kubernetes para ver las etiquetas y las manchas aplicadas a los nodos virtuales.
- Utilice el separador Nodos virtuales para ver información sobre nodos del trabajador específicos en el pool de nodo virtual.
- Utilice el separador Solicitudes de trabajo para realizar las siguientes tareas:
- Obtenga los detalles de una solicitud de trabajo concreta para el recurso de pool de nodos virtuales.
- Muestre las solicitudes de trabajo para el recurso del pool de nodos virtuales.
Para obtener más información, consulte Visualización de solicitudes de trabajo.
- Utilice el separador Etiquetas para agregar o modificar las etiquetas aplicadas al pool de nodos virtuales. El etiquetado permite agrupar recursos dispares entre compartimentos y permite anotar recursos con sus propios metadatos. Para obtener más información, consulte Etiquetado de recursos relacionados con el cluster de Kubernetes.
Utilice el comando oci ce virtual-node-pool update y los parámetros necesarios para actualizar un pool de nodos virtuales:
oci ce virtual-node-pool update --virtual-node-pool-id <virtual-node-pool-ocid> [OPTIONS]
Para obtener una lista completa de parámetros y valores para los comandos de la CLI, consulte la Referencia de comandos de la CLI.
Ejecute la operación UpdateVirtualNodePool para actualizar un pool de nodos virtual.